The Lure Of The Countryside - A Nature Lover's Pot-pourri (Hardcover)


Originally published London 1927. The well illustrated contents contain a multitude of nature notes and observations made throughout the English year. Each season is described in detail with anecdotes of country life and ways intermingled with jottings on animal and bird life. The flora and fauna of the English countryside are brought to life through the pages of this fascinating book. Many of the earliest countryside books, particularly those dating back to the 1900s and before, are now extremely scarce and increasingly expensive. Home Farm Books are republishing many of these classic works in affordable, high quality, modern editions, using the original text and artwork.
